Role summary
This role is responsible for driving pre-sales solutioning for Microsoft Dynamics 365 Customer Engagement (CE) and Power Platform offerings. The architect will lead proposal development, create solution blueprints, and make Fit-to-Purpose design choices across all CE modules and Power Platform components to deliver scalable, innovative solutions.
What you will do
- Lead end to end pre-sales including RFP response, estimation, solution blueprint, architecture design and implementation plan for D365 CE modules including Sales, Customer Service, Marketing, Field Service, Power Platform, XRM and other latest Microsoft releases
- Keep to date with latest Microsoft releases and to be on the forefront of designing solutions
- Leverage other Microsoft stack like Azure service bus, ADF,CO-Pilot/ co-pilot studio, PowerBI, M365, Teams, Outlook, Viva suite and other accelerators/ISVs to design compelling solutions to create market differentiation
- Develop Fit-to-Purpose design choices ensuring scalability, performance, and cost optimization.
- Create solution blueprints, implementation plans, scope, assumptions, and dependencies.
- Provide effort estimation and pricing models for proposals.
- Design and deliver solutions using Power Platform components: Power Pages, Canvas Apps, Model-Driven Apps, Power Automate, and Power BI.
- Ensure integration with Dataverse and other Microsoft ecosystem services.
- Analyze competitor offerings and position our solutions effectively.
- Represent KDN Microsoft in wider KPMG global network, forums, webinars, and client workshops.
- Publish whitepapers, blogs, and reusable solution assets.
- Collaborate with Microsoft Fast track teams to ensure the proposed solutions are appropriate
- Build strong network with key KPMG member firm contacts to drive impact for KDN advisory
- Develop reusable assets /frameworks that creates market differentiation
- Pre-pare and socialize delivery best practices, tools, templates and mentor delivery center colleagues globally
- Proven track record in pre-sales roles within large consulting or professional services firms.
- Expertise in all D365 CE modules: Sales, Customer Service, Marketing, Field Service.
- Hands-on experience with Power Platform: Power Pages, Canvas Apps, Model-Driven Apps, Power Automate, Power BI, Azure, Dataverse , M365 etc
- Experience with Copilot integration for Dynamics 365 and Power Platform.
- Certifications: Microsoft Certified: Dynamics 365 Solution Architect Expert, Power Platform Solution Architect Expert.
- Industry experience: Financial Services, Insurance, Healthcare, Industrial Manufacturing, E-Commerce/Retail.
- Exceptional communication and presentation skills.
- Strong cross-boundary collaboration and stakeholder management.
- Proven expertise in creating creative Industry/function solutions leveraging D365 CE and Power platform to deliver rapid POCs and Demos during pre-sales cycle
- Existing Microsoft MVP for Fabric (Preferred)
